Ever Clean Scleral for Contact Lenses (Soft and RGP Contact Lens Soaking Solution).

  • AVIZOR S.A.
  • Waiting data.

Details

How Supplied
Sterilised Preservative Free contact lens soaking solution with neutralising tablets in (2 x 350ml + tablets) plastic bottle with scleral lens case.
Dosing
ECP/HCP to advise. All Pxs should be instructed to read and ensure they understand the instructions in the Patient Information Leaflet before using product.
Formulation
Sterile solution containing:, Hydrogen Peroxide 3%, Bi-layer tablet containing: Boric Acid Buffer (pH range in the eye at 7.2), Sodium Chloride, Catalase, Chlorophyll and Riboflavin.
Contact Lens Use
Yes, prime indication.
Indications
One step peroxide system with a new specific lens case for scleral lenses with large diameter 23mm and sagittal height 9mm.
Contra-Indications/Cautions
Hypersensitivity to product/class/component. All pts should be instructed to read and ensure they understand the instructions the Patient Information Leaflet before using product. "Store at room temperature". "Leave lenses for a minimum of 2 hours during the disinfection and neutralising process". Use solution within 60 days of opening. Remove tablets from packaging only when ready to use. "If solution in the case is colourless the pt must repeat the disinfection and neutralisation process before wearing. "(Pt) never (to) use tap (or other water) for soft contact lenses". Not to be mixed with other solutions. Pt "may store ... lenses up to 48 hours in closed lens case". Pt must not put neutralised disinfecting solution directly in eye. Pregnancy/lactation - EDDB. Advise pt to read and understand all accompanying product information before first use - EDDB.
Adverse Reactions
Acute stinging if disinfecting solution not fully neutralised - pt to be seen by ECP - EDDB. "In case of irritation, consult contact lens specialist". If irritation occurs, persists or increases, pt to remove CL from eye, discontinue use and consult ECP/HCP - EDDB. If vision changes or irritation occurs, persists or increases, pt to discontinue use and consult ECP/HCP.
